Janet M. Lewis Obituary

Born August 8, 1935 in Scranton, PA to John and Wilhelmina Bierwirth.

Graduated from Scranton Technical High School in 1953 the proceeded to Lackawanna College and the University of Scranton where she achieved her Master’s Degree.

She was happily married to Kenneth G Lewis for 60 years.

Janet was employed by Penn Dot Engineering District office in Dunmore, where she was a supervisor. Also, she was a part time professor at Lackawanna College.

Janet was a resident of Clarks Summit Senior Living and prior to that she was a life long resident of Dunmore PA.

She was very active in the community, especially at the Dunmore Senior Center, she was also an avid dancer and an accomplished artist with Pocono Painters. When Janet wasn’t spending the hobbies, she loved spending all of her time with family and friends.

She is survived by her 3 children: Ken Jr and wife Margie, Aberdeen MD, Evan and wife Ann, Clarks Summit PA, and Jeannine and companion Ed Felinski, Hummelstown, PA. Also, her 4 beloved grandchildren Joseph, Jennifer, Michael and Matthew plus numerous great grandchildren, nieces and nephews.

Funeral Services will be held on Saturday, May 24th at St Peter's Lutheran Church – 1000 Taylor Ave Scranton PA at 9:30am followed by her burial at the Dunmore Cemetery, Dunmore PA.
